4. Description, Modbus Gateway Properties

The following MESR9xx Modbus Gateway properties are ordered alphabetically to assist you in finding the information you need.

Attached

The Attached is selectable between Master and Slaves. If Master is selected, it will run in TCP server mode, if Slaves is selected, it will run in TCP client mode.

Baud Rate

Baud Rate is the communication speed of the link between the Modbus gateway and the device attached to its serial port. Both these devices must be configured to operate at the same baud rate. Baud rate values range from 75 to 230,400 Baud. (Refer to Appendix B for specific baud rates that are supported.)

Character Timeout

Character Timeout controls the maximum duration between received characters before sending the characters to the network. Larger values may decrease the number of network packets, but increase the amount of time to receive characters. Smaller values may increase the number of network packets, but decrease the amount of time to receive characters. The range is 1 through 65535.

Configuration Files

Configuration files contain all configuration settings for the Modbus gateway. When the Modbus gateway settings have been configured you can save the settings using Vlinx Manager. Existing configuration files can be Opened (from Vlinx Manager), which loads them into the Modbus gateway. This allows the same configuration to be applied to multiple Modbus gateways, or to reload a previously used configuration.
